A good student council election speech should highlight your qualifications, relevant experience, and ideas for improving the school. Focus on the changes you would like to see, how you plan to make a positive impact, and why your classmates should trust you with their vote. Remember to be genuine, enthusiastic, and relatable to connect with your audience.

What is a good Persuasive student council treasurer speech?

A good persuasive student council treasurer speech should focus on highlighting your qualifications, experience with handling money, and commitment to being responsible and transparent in managing finances. You can also mention your willingness to collaborate with other council members to ensure the financial success of the student body. Connecting with your audience by incorporating humor or personal anecdotes can help make your speech memorable and engaging.

What is a good speech for student council in 5th grade?

For a 5th grade student council speech, focus on introducing yourself, sharing why you want to be part of student council, and expressing your ideas for improving the school. Discuss how you will represent your classmates' voices and work to make positive changes. Keep it simple, genuine, and don't forget to include a catchy slogan or campaign promise!


What should be in a SRC speech?

A good student council (SRC) speech should introduce yourself, state your qualifications and why you're running, share your vision or goals if elected, and end with a call to action for your classmates to vote for you. It's important to be authentic, positive, and clear in your message to garner support from your peers.
